The conventional minimum investment quantity has boosted to $1.8 million (from $1 million) to represent inflation. The minimal financial investment in a TEA has actually enhanced to $900,000 (from $500,000) to make up inflation. Future changes will likewise be connected to inflation (per the Customer Rate Index for All Urban Consumers, or CPI-U) and take place every 5 years.

You need to be certain to suggest that EB-5 can be a potential pathway to a permit in your assessments with customers. Customers birthed in China Recommended Reading or India often deal with lengthy EB-2 or EB-3 stockpiles. EB-5 provides an actual alternative, especially without present stockpile for financial investments in rural or high-unemployment locations.

Customers with an E-2 visa that want long-term house, or may be not likely to obtain an extension, might have the ability to leverage their E-2 business investments in the direction of the EB-5 requirements. This can mean attributing their investment amount and jobs developed in the direction of the EB-5 demands. This route usually verifies to be the only sensible choice for a permit from their nonimmigrant visa status.
